*Delhi University has started registrations for admission to its undergraduate programs through CUET UG scores for the academic year 2025-26*. Here's what you need to know : - *Registration Portal*: The DU CSAS portal is live now at ugadmission-eks.uod.ac.in. - *Registration Process*: Candidates need to type their CUET UG 2025 application number and date of birth to register for the counseling session. - *Required Documents*: - CUET UG 2025 Application Number - Class 10th Certificate and Mark Sheet - Class 12th Certificate and Mark Sheet - Sports Certificates (if applying under sports quota) - Candidate’s Photograph (automatically fetched from CUET UG application form) - *Important Dates*: - Registration started on June 13, 2025 - Last date for CSAS UG 2025 registration is expected to be in the last week of July 2025 - Filling of preferred course and college will also be done in the last week of July 2025 - Release of CUET DU cut off 2025 is expected in the first week of August 2025 - *Admission Process*: The DU Common Seat Allocation System (UG) 2025 includes: 1. Applying to the University of Delhi with a registration fee of INR 100 2. Completing the candidate profile 3. Applying to programs and colleges 4. Paying the registration fee for each program For more updates, you can check the official DU website or contact the helpline at ug@admission.du.ac.in or 011-27666073. The main difference between a 3rd year degree and a 4th year degree lies in the academic depth, research exposure, and potential career benefits. Here's a breakdown: *Key Differences:* - *Degree Title*: Completing three years will earn you a standard degree (BA, BSc, or BCom), while completing four years can lead to an Honours with Research degree, provided you undertake a research-based track. - *Research Exposure*: The fourth year provides an opportunity to engage in research projects, academic papers, or entrepreneurial ventures, which can be beneficial for students aiming for research-heavy institutions or careers. - *Career Benefits*: A four-year degree can give you an edge in competitive applications, especially for students eyeing opportunities abroad or in research-oriented fields. - *Credit Requirements*: To graduate after four years, you'll need to complete 176 credits, compared to 132 credits in three years. *Who Should Consider the Fourth Year:* - *Students aiming for foreign universities* that require a four-year UG degree - *Those interested in research careers*, policy work, or fellowships - *Programme students* who want to convert their general degree into an Honours degree *Who Might Want to Exit After Three Years:* - *Students with clear plans for postgraduate studies in India*, where a two-year Master's is the norm - *Those preparing for competitive exams* or seeking early job placements - *Students concerned about infrastructure gaps* or academic uncertainty in the fourth year. NOTICE FOR INTERNAL ASSESSMENT OF POST GRADUATE COURSES All concerned students of Post-graduate courses of II/IV Semesters are hereby informed that final chance is being provided to those students who were unable to complete their Internal Assessment (Online) due to the following reasons: - 1) Technical glitches such as auto-submission or system errors. 2) Not attempted their Internal Assessment (IA) for any reasons. The Internal Assessment (IA) portal will be opened from 10.06.2025 to 16.06.2025 (11.59 pm). No further chance will be given in this respect in any circumstances.
